Grease composition and sliding member coated therewith
11162045 · 2021-11-02 · ·

Grease composition contains (A) a straight-chain perfluoropolyether having a kinematic viscosity of 2-110 mm.sup.2/s at 40° C., (B) a branched perfluoropolyether having a kinematic viscosity of 2-100 mm.sup.2/s at 40° C., and (C) a fluorocarbon resin powder having a primary particle size of 1 μm or less, wherein the contained amount of the fluorocarbon resin powder is 25-40 wt % with respect to the weight of the grease composition, and the weight ratio of the straight-chain perfluoropolyether (A) to the branched perfluoropolyether (B) is 15:85 to 70:30.

COMPOSITIONS OF HFO-1234YF AND R-161 AND SYSTEMS FOR USING THE COMPOSITIONS

Environmentally friendly refrigerant blends utilizing blends including 2,3,3,3-tetrafluoropropene (HFO-1234yf) and fluoroethane (HFC-161). The blends have ultra-low GWP, low toxicity, and low flammability with low temperature glide or nearly negligible glide for use in a hybrid, mild hybrid, plug-in hybrid, or full electric vehicles for thermal management (transferring heat from one part of the vehicle to the other) of the passenger compartment providing air conditioning (A/C) or heating to the passenger cabin.

Low-friction fluorinated coatings

Low-friction fluorinated coatings are disclosed herein. A preferred low-friction material contains a low-surface-energy fluoropolymer having a surface energy between about 5 mJ/m.sup.2 to about 50 mJ/m.sup.2, and a hygroscopic material that is covalently connected to the fluoropolymer in a triblock copolymer, such as PEG-PFPE-PEG. The material forms a lubricating surface layer in the presence of humidity. An exemplary copolymer comprises fluoropolymers with average molecular weight from 500 g/mol to 20,000 g/mol, wherein the fluoropolymers are (α,ω)-hydroxyl-terminated and/or (α,ω)-amine-terminated, and wherein the fluoropolymers are present in the triblock structure T-(CH.sub.2—CH.sub.2—O)—CH.sub.2—CF.sub.2—O—(CF.sub.2—CF.sub.2—O).sub.m(CF.sub.2—O).sub.n—CF.sub.2—CH.sub.2—(O—CH.sub.2—CH.sub.2).sub.p-T where T is a hydroxyl or amine terminal group, p=1 to 50, m=1 to 100, and n=1 to 100. The copolymer also contains isocyanate species and polyol or polyamine chain extenders or crosslinkers possessing a functionality of preferably 3 or greater. These durable, solvent-resistant, and transparent coatings reduce insect debris following impact.

Fluoropolyether compound, lubricant using same, and usage thereof

Provided are a lubricant that is highly resistant to contamination and highly thermally stable, a lubricant that is highly durable and highly heat resistant, and a magnetic disk. A fluoropolyether compound contains perfluoropolyether groups, end groups each containing at least one hydroxyl group, and a linking group that is comprised of a C.sub.4-C.sub.14 hydrocarbon group and that contains at least one hydroxyl group.

Lubricating Agent Solution, Magnetic Disk And Method For Manufacturing Same
20220275305 · 2022-09-01 ·

Provided is a lubricant solution capable of being applied to a magnetic disk without use of a fluorine solvent. A lubricant solution in accordance with an aspect of the present invention includes: water; and a perfluoropolyether compound that satisfies Expression (I) below:


N.sub.OH/(Mn/1500)≥2  (1), where N.sub.OH represents the number of hydroxyl groups per molecule of the perfluoropolyether compound and Mn represents a number average molecular weight of the perfluoropolyether compound.
